A multinational group operating in the industrial sector for the production of electrical/electronic measuring instruments and systems for the diagnostics of MV/HV electrical systems, in order to strengthen its staff at the Casalecchio di Reno (BO) site, is seeking a: “FULL STACK DEVELOPER”.
Responsibilities
The role will be responsible for product requirements analysis, support in design activities, development, maintenance and validation of communication, management and data processing software, as well as related user interfaces for embedded systems and monitoring and supervision applications (SCADA systems). The selected candidate will also interact with other company departments to facilitate the distribution, production and support of products/systems.
Requirements
The candidate, preferably with a university-level education (Electronic Engineering, Computer Engineering or similar), has gained several years of experience in similar roles within modern, well-structured companies operating in the industrial automation sector. Availability to (rarely) travel in Italy and abroad to interact directly with customers as part of the job is required. A good command of the English language is required. Previous experience working in Agile environments and with version control software will be considered a plus.
Required Skills
Excellent knowledge of the .NET framework, ASP.NET MVC, WPF
Excellent knowledge of major programming patterns
Strong knowledge of JavaScript, Angular and main frameworks
ORM (NHibernate, Entity Framework)
MongoDB, SQL (Microsoft SQL Server 2012)
SOA architecture
Development of multithreading and event-driven applications
Knowledge of Java, Python, C++ and experience in Linux environments is appreciated
